"This card-table display is on the right as you walk in the door of Champagne's small bakery. The paper-wrapped loaves have a brittle-crisp crust. Those in plastic are soft and spongy."

"Champagne's is no Johnny-come-lately. A Breaux Bridge bakery since 1889, it has a wonderfully weathered aura, inside and out."
